How is similarity to Lucius calculated?
We compare Lucius against every game in our catalog using 11 gameplay attributes: genre, atmosphere, world structure, play modes, combat style, and more. Each category is weighted differently — genre matters more than visual style, for instance. The result is a 0-100 score reflecting how closely a game replicates the Lucius experience, not just whether it shares the same genre label.
